differences are celebrated, and horizons are limitless. Our dynamic and
successful Water Resources group is seeking an entry level engineer to
join their team. This position would be based in our Minneapolis, MN;
St. Paul, MN; or Madison, WI office. This is an opportunity to work in a
team atmosphere with experienced project engineers applying various
design, engineering, and modeling tools in the development of water
resource projects for federal, state, and local clients as well as for
private industry. Responsibilities: Roadway drainage system layout and
design, including new and retrofit systems and design of Best Management
Practices (BMPs). Site design, including BMP design, modeling, and Low
Impact Development (LID) practices. Design of stormwater reuse systems,
green infrastructure, and other sustainable stormwater management
systems. Surface water management planning, feasibility studies, and
assessments. Hydrologic and Hydraulic (H&H) modeling. Hydraulic analysis
related to bridge, culvert, channel, and revetment design.
Bioengineering design relating to surface water conveyance systems such
as stream bank stabilization and restoration as well as wetland creation
and restoration. Design of erosion control and sediment management BMPs.
Wetland and floodplain mitigation analysis and permitting. Development
of the water resources component of environmental documents (EA, EAW,
EIS). Additional duties as assigned. Requirements Qualifications: A...
